[Remote] AI Engineer
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Eliassen Group is seeking an AI-focused engineer to build backend services and AI agents that execute end-to-end business workflows. The role involves designing and deploying retrieval-augmented generation systems for AI-driven lookups across enterprise data and integrating agents with secure, scalable services.
Responsibilities
- Build AI agents that plan and execute business workflows with multi-step actions, including understanding requests, retrieving context, taking actions, verifying results, and logging outcomes
- Translate ambiguous business problems into repeatable agent workflows with tool and function calling, orchestration logic, and structured outputs
- Design and implement RAG pipelines across structured and unstructured sources, optimizing retrieval quality and grounding
- Implement retrieval strategies that support AI-driven database lookups using semantic search, metadata filters, and business rules
- Integrate agents into backend services via APIs and microservices, delivering reliable endpoints and orchestration layers with auditability and operational controls
- Partner with data and platform teams to ensure scalable and governed data access patterns, including caching, latency constraints, access controls, and logging
- Assess and recommend agent and RAG frameworks and deploy solutions in production-ready architectures
- Implement observability with tracing, evaluation harnesses, and drift monitoring to improve solution quality and cost and performance
- Add guardrails for prompt injection defenses, output validation, and PII handling to align with responsible AI expectations
- Establish quality gates and fallback behaviors so agents fail safely and predictably
Skills
- Hands-on experience building agentic AI solutions, including LLM tool and function calling, multi-step workflows, and orchestration patterns
- Strong data experience across structured and unstructured sources, including data modeling intuition and data readiness assessment, and collaboration with analytics and data engineering teams
- Proven experience implementing RAG in production or near-production environments, including ingestion, chunking or indexing, retrieval, reranking, and grounding
- Backend engineering fundamentals including APIs, service design, reliability patterns, and integration with enterprise systems
- Proficiency in Python and or another backend language such as Java, Go, or TypeScript, with strong software engineering practices including testing, code review, and CI or CD
